Understanding Legal Rights and Duties

In the immediate aftermath of a car accident, it’s imperative to understand your legal rights and obligations. The law requires that all parties stay at the scene until it’s appropriate to leave. Failing to do so may result in hit-and-run charges, a legal obligation that carries severe penalties.

An aspect of rights awareness that’s often overlooked is the right to remain silent. Any statement you make can be used against you in court, so it’s important to use discretion when speaking with other involved parties or law enforcement.

Another essential right to be aware of is your entitlement to legal representation. This is particularly important when the accident involves injury, considerable property damage or a dispute about who is at fault. An attorney specializing in personal injury law can help navigate the complexities of your case, ensuring your rights are upheld.

Moreover, you have the responsibility to report the accident to the appropriate authorities and your insurance company. This legal obligation is often time-sensitive, so swift action is advisable.

Understanding your legal rights and obligations after a car accident can greatly impact the resolution of your case. Therefore, rights awareness is key in avoiding unnecessary legal complications.

Understanding Insurance Claim Basics

Grasping the basics of insurance claims can be the key to securing the compensation you deserve after a car accident. Understanding the process can prepare you for potential hurdles, such as policy limits and claim denials, and guarantee you are adequately equipped to navigate the complex world of insurance claims.

Policy limits define the maximum amount an insurance company will pay for a particular claim. Knowing these limits in your policy can prevent unexpected financial burdens. It is essential to be aware that exceeding these limits can lead to out-of-pocket expenses.

Claim denials, on the other hand, occur when an insurance company refuses to pay a claim. Understanding the reasons for claim denials can help you prevent them. Common reasons may include policy exclusions, lapses in coverage, or lack of proof of loss.

Dealing With Insurance Adjusters

Dealing with insurance adjusters is an integral part of the insurance claim process. These professionals are employed by insurance companies, and their job is to evaluate accident documentation, interpret policies, and determine the extent of the insurer’s financial responsibility. Although their role is essential, it’s critical to understand that their primary loyalty lies with the insurance company, not with you.

This reality underscores the importance of being prepared for insurance tactics that are designed to minimize the payout. Adjuster communication requires careful navigation. They are trained in claim negotiations and employ settlement strategies that can be confusing and overwhelming. Additionally, adjuster pressure is often used to prompt quick settlements, even before all accident-related expenses are known. This approach often exploits the claim timelines, capitalizing on your possible lack of understanding of the insurance claim process.

However, with a professional legal advisor at your side, you can effectively counter these tactics. An experienced attorney can facilitate policy interpretation, handle claim negotiations, resist adjuster pressure, and guarantee that the claim timelines are adhered to. In this way, you can secure a fair outcome, reflective of the full scope of the accident’s impact on your life.

Understanding Third-Party Claims

Ever wondered how to manage third-party claims after a car accident? Understanding the complexities of these claims can be the key to receiving fair compensation. Third-party liability refers to a situation where a person or entity is legally responsible for the damages or injuries you sustained in the accident. This could be the other driver, a vehicle manufacturer, or even a government entity, depending on the circumstances of the accident.

The process starts with thorough claim documentation. This includes medical records, police reports, and any other evidence that supports your claim. It’s essential to gather and preserve these documents as they will form the basis of your claim. Inadequate documentation may lead to a denial or underpayment of your claim.

Moreover, understanding third-party claims helps you navigate through the legal landscape of claims and compensation. It allows you to identify who is at fault accurately, ensuring that the responsible party is held accountable. Remember, legal assistance in such cases can make a significant difference. Avoiding Costly Mistakes in Settlements

As we turn our attention to the matter of settlements, it’s important to contemplate the potential pitfalls that might arise. One of the most common costly errors victims encounter is making mistaken assumptions about the worth of their claim. By prematurely accepting a settlement offer without fully understanding all potential damages, one might shortchange themselves, missing out on significant compensation.

Emotional reactions can further exacerbate this problem. The aftermath of an accident can be highly traumatic and emotionally charged, often leading victims to make hasty decisions in the hope of achieving quick closure. However, these quick settlements seldom reflect the true value of a claim.

To avoid these mistakes, it’s essential to secure legal help. Experienced car accident attorneys possess the expertise to effectively evaluate your claim, taking into account all possible damages – including those that might not be immediately apparent. They can negotiate assertively on your behalf, ensuring you get a fair settlement that fully compensates your losses.

Gathering and Preserving Evidence

Frequently, the success of a car accident claim hinges on the quality and quantity of evidence gathered and preserved. The aftermath of an accident can be chaotic, making it vital to swiftly collect and accurately document evidence.

Essential to this process are witness statements. The accounts of impartial bystanders provide a unique, unbiased perspective on the accident, potentially corroborating your version of events. Consequently, gathering these statements promptly, before memories fade or details become blurred, is paramount.

Equally important is the collection of digital evidence. This can include photographs or videos of the accident scene, the vehicles involved, and any injuries sustained. Today’s smartphones make it easier than ever to capture high-quality digital evidence. However, understanding what to photograph or record, and how to do it effectively, can make the difference between a persuasive piece of evidence and a useless one.

Preserving this evidence is also critical. All digital data should be backed up, and physical evidence, like vehicle parts or clothing, should be stored in a safe location. Legal assistance can guarantee that evidence is properly collected, catalogued, and preserved, thus strengthening your claim and ensuring the best possible outcome.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is the Typical Duration of a Car Accident Lawsuit?

The typical duration of a car accident lawsuit can vary, but often spans several months to years. This lawsuit timeline is dependent on the complexities of the case and the efficiency of the legal process.

How Do I Find a Reputable Car Accident Lawyer in My Area?

To find a reputable car accident lawyer, consider online reviews and local referrals. Research their experience, success rates, and customer feedback. Schedule consultations to evaluate their expertise and guarantee they align with your specific needs.

What Costs Are Associated With Hiring a Car Accident Lawyer?

Hiring a car accident lawyer typically involves costs such as legal fees. However, many operate on contingency agreements, meaning you only pay if they win your case, ensuring accessibility to legal assistance regardless of financial capacity.

What if the Person Who Hit Me Doesnt Have Car Insurance?

If the at-fault party lacks insurance, your uninsured motorist coverage may compensate for damages. However, maneuvering this process can be complex. Utilizing legal aid resources guarantees your rights are protected and maximizes potential compensation.

Can I Still Get Compensation if the Accident Was Partly My Fault?

Yes, it’s possible to obtain compensation even if the accident was partly your fault, due to the principle of comparative negligence. This can impact insurance claims, making legal advice essential for steering through this complex situation.
